Vinayaka Chavithi in Telangana

Called Vinayaka Chavithi. Clay idols, the 21-leaf puja and undrallu are central. Community mandapams run for days, the Khairatabad idol in Hyderabad being the largest and drawing the biggest immersion procession.

The regional form observed across Telangana and Andhra Pradesh. How any one household or village keeps it varies, and is not something recorded here.

When the idol is immersed

The idol is kept for one and a half, three, five, seven days or until Anant Chaturdashi — it is a family custom rather than a rule, and community mandapams usually keep it longest.

Use the designated immersion point

Many gram panchayats and municipalities set aside a pond or a marked stretch of tank for immersion. Ask at the panchayat office — it changes year to year, and a drinking-water tank or a farm pond is not an alternative.

Unpainted clay dissolves, plaster of Paris does not

A clay idol breaks down in water within hours. Plaster of Paris does not, and the paints carry heavy metals, so idols accumulate in tanks and rivers after immersion. Pollution control boards in most states now ask for clay for exactly this reason.

Someone should be watching the water, not the idol

Immersion points get crowded and the bank is slippery after the monsoon. Children go into the water at these gatherings every year. Keep one person watching the water rather than the procession.

Take the accessories home

Thermocol, plastic sheeting, cloth and metal ornaments do not belong in the tank even when the idol itself is clay. Most organised immersion points now have a collection bin at the bank for them.

Siddapur at a glance

Siddapur is a village of 793 people in 162 households (Census 2011) in Pitlam mandal, Kamareddy district, Telangana, the 19th-largest of 27 villages in Pitlam mandal. Literacy is 40%, 4 points below the mandal average of 44% and the sex ratio is 987 women per 1,000 men. It lies 50 km from the Kamareddy district centre, 5 km from Kotgiri, the nearest town, 6 km from Bodhan railway station (straight-line distances). The pincode is 503310, served by Pitlam post office; the LGD village code is 571395. The nearest hospital or health centre is Government Unani Dispensary, Rudrur (NRHM), 5 km away. The population is estimated at 935 in 2026, up 18% since the 2011 Census.
